Semaglutide is a Metabolic peptide.
This Peptide is approved for type 2 diabetes and chronic weight management, significantly lowering HbA1c and body weight by modulating incretin pathways232480
Semaglutide is a modified GLP-1(7–37) analog with three key changes—Ala8→Aib, Lys26 acylated with a C18 fatty diacid, and Lys34→Arg—resulting in a long-acting GLP-1 receptor agonist that enhances glucose-dependent insulin secretion, suppresses glucagon, slows gastric emptying, and reduces appetite23647480
Semaglutide is a Receptor agonist.
GLP-1 receptor (GLP1R) on pancreatic β-cells and other tissues2380
31-amino-acid backbone based on human GLP-1(7–37) with Aib8, Arg34, and a C18 fatty acid chain attached to Lys26; overall modified GLP-1 sequence 236474
31 amino acids
Synthetic analog of human GLP-1 derived from proglucagon648089
